Address: Sinclair Street, Drouin, VIC 3818


Facilities

The Drouin Recreation Reserve (also known as the Drouin Showgrounds) serves as a primary service stop for travelers in the West Gippsland region, providing essential utilities within a large sporting complex.

* Public Toilets: Located within the main pavilion and near the Drouin Recreation Reserve Playground.

* Recreation: Features extensive netball courts, a football oval, and a large fenced playground for families.

Picnic Facilities: Includes sheltered areas with BBQ tables and public bins throughout the reserve.

Pet-Friendly: Dogs are permitted within the grounds but must remain on a lead at all times.


How to Find This Location

The dump point is situated at the eastern end of the Drouin Recreation Reserve, conveniently located near the town center.

  1. Main Access: From the Princes Way (main street of Drouin), turn onto Sinclair Street heading south.

  2. Entrance: Follow Sinclair Street past the Drouin Primary School toward the reserve entrance.

  3. On-Site: Enter the reserve and follow the internal road toward the hockey and netball pavilion area.

  4. Location: The dump point is positioned near the amenities block and pavilion for easy drive-through access.

  5. Navigation: The reserve offers a large, level gravel surface with wide access roads, making it suitable for motorhomes, large caravans, and "Big Rigs."

Note: While the facility is generally accessible 24/7, access to certain parts of the reserve may be restricted during major sporting events or the annual Drouin Show. For additional assistance, the Baw Baw Shire Council can be contacted on 1300 229 229.
